Agriculture has always been the backbone of human civilization, but the industry faces growing challenges in the modern world. Climate change, resource scarcity, inefficient supply chains, and lack of financial inclusion for small farmers all pose significant obstacles to sustainable farming practices. As governments and organizations push for greener solutions, cryptocurrency and blockchain technology are emerging as unlikely allies in the fight for a more sustainable agricultural future. By enabling transparent supply chains, fairer financial systems, and innovative incentive structures, crypto is reshaping how food is grown, traded, and consumed. Financial Inclusion for Small Farmers
One of the greatest barriers to sustainable agriculture is the lack of access to financing. Smallholder farmers, especially in developing countries, often struggle to obtain loans or credit to purchase seeds, equipment, or environmentally friendly technologies. Traditional banking systems are either inaccessible or charge high fees that make credit unsustainable. Cryptocurrency offers an alternative. With digital wallets, farmers can receive payments, secure microloans, and participate in decentralized finance (DeFi) without the need for a physical bank account. This financial inclusion empowers them to invest in better farming practices, adopt renewable technologies, and reduce reliance on exploitative intermediaries. By cutting out middlemen, farmers retain a larger share of their profits, directly supporting sustainable growth.
Transparent and Ethical Supply Chains
Food traceability has become a pressing issue, as consumers demand to know the origins of their food and its environmental impact. Blockchain technology, which underpins cryptocurrency systems, allows for transparent and immutable tracking of agricultural goods. Every stage—from planting and harvesting to processing and delivery—can be recorded on a blockchain ledger, ensuring that products are verified, authentic, and sustainably sourced. This level of transparency discourages unethical practices such as deforestation, overfishing, or unfair labor. Farmers and cooperatives that adhere to eco-friendly methods can prove their commitment, gaining the trust of both regulators and consumers. At the same time, retailers and restaurants can guarantee that their supply chains align with sustainability goals, building stronger brand loyalty.
Incentivizing Green Practices Through Tokenization
Another powerful way crypto is supporting sustainable agriculture is through tokenized incentives. Platforms are creating reward systems where farmers earn tokens for adopting practices such as regenerative farming, organic cultivation, or reduced pesticide usage. These tokens can then be exchanged for goods, services, or fiat currency, providing a direct financial reward for sustainability. Carbon credit markets are also being transformed by blockchain. By tokenizing carbon credits, farmers who implement carbon-reducing practices, such as reforestation or soil regeneration, can sell their credits in decentralized marketplaces. This not only encourages eco-friendly behavior but also creates a new source of income for those on the front lines of environmental stewardship.
Reducing Food Waste and Enhancing Efficiency
Food waste contributes significantly to environmental degradation, with millions of tons wasted every year due to inefficient logistics and distribution. Blockchain-based platforms help track inventory, demand, and transportation routes more effectively, reducing spoilage and ensuring products reach consumers faster. Smart contracts, powered by blockchain, automate transactions and logistics, ensuring that payments are made promptly when certain conditions are met. This reduces delays, lowers waste, and guarantees fair treatment of farmers. By optimizing supply chains, crypto solutions reduce the environmental footprint of agriculture while improving economic resilience.
Real-World Projects Driving Change
Several innovative projects are already using cryptocurrency to promote sustainable agriculture. Initiatives in Africa and Asia are leveraging blockchain to provide transparent records of land ownership, giving farmers security over their property and encouraging long-term sustainable investment. Platforms like AgUnity are enabling smallholder farmers to record transactions securely, improving trust and accountability in cooperative farming systems. Other projects are focusing on tokenized carbon credits, allowing farmers to monetize their sustainability efforts on a global scale. These developments show that crypto is not just a theoretical tool but a practical solution already reshaping the agricultural sector.
Challenges and Future Outlook
While the potential is vast, challenges remain. Cryptocurrency volatility, limited internet access in rural areas, and the need for regulatory clarity all pose hurdles to widespread adoption. Additionally, blockchain systems themselves must evolve to become more energy-efficient to align with the goals of sustainability. However, as renewable-powered blockchain solutions and scalable technologies continue to emerge, these barriers are gradually being overcome. The growing intersection between agriculture, crypto, and sustainability is paving the way for a more inclusive and environmentally conscious future.
